Output 81d34f984141ae42b2521c07c8c6a8136a407f53a0629c57f4efca79a227036e:0

value
877081154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cc761ef5446fb0e4183aeb6716b6f8eabb26c71 OP_EQUAL
address
3BcBkc1bjqbswTLb2SCERxFJnPakbpfYLV
transaction
81d34f984141ae42b2521c07c8c6a8136a407f53a0629c57f4efca79a227036e
spent
true